Title (up) A Comparative Analysis On Using Several Virtual Instrumentation Software In Education Type
Year 2009 Publication Csedu 2009: Proceedings Of The First International Conference On Computer Supported Education Abbreviated Journal
Volume I Issue Pages 435-438
Keywords
Abstract Using Virtual Experiments become one of the main methods for Science teaching in actual Education. Their power on creating simulation-based learning environments is well-known and many teachers have already adopted the virtual experiments to be used in their classrooms. The great extension of the Virtual experiments determined 9 institutions to propose a Socrates-Comenius 2.1. European project called VccSSe – Virtual Community Collaborating Space for Science Education project (code: 128989-CP-1-2006-1-RO-COMENIUS-C21) coordinated by Valahia University of Targoviste, Romania which has as main objective to adapt, develop, test, implement and disseminate training modules, teaching methodologies and pedagogical strategies based on the use of Virtual Instruments, with the view to their implementation in the classrooms. In the first year of the project, three software products were chosen for developing the process of training: Cabri Geometry II, LabVIEW and Crocodile Clips. This paper presents the results of a comparative analysis, made by the tutors who trained the in-serviced teachers on using the mentioned software products.

Author Suduc, A.-M.; Bizoi, M.; Gorghiu, G.; Gorghiu, L.-M.
Title (up) Digital images, video and web conferences in education: a case study Type
Year 2012 Publication 4th World Conference On Educational Sciences (Wces-2012) Abbreviated Journal
Volume 46 Issue Pages 4102-4106
Keywords
Abstract Although the access to the computers and the Internet at home is quite widespread in the European countries, the use of them at home for school related learning activities comparing to the use for entertainment is much lower with about 30 percentages (Eurydice, 2011). The paper aims to present an analysis of the feedback collected from a group of teachers, from 9 counties, after they have been trained, within a POSDRU project, to integrate in education different multimedia applications. Among others, the results shows that although most of the teachers have a computer in their classroom or constant access to a computer room (78%) with Internet access (66%), only a low number of the teachers have used in the past digital images, videos and web conferences in the teaching-learning-evaluation process. Author Suduc, A.-M.; Bizoi, M.; Gorghiu, G.; Gorghiu, L.M.
Title (up) Information and communication technologies in science education Type
Year 2011 Publication 3rd World Conference On Educational Sciences (2011) Abbreviated Journal
Volume 15 Issue Pages
Keywords
Abstract The advancements in information and communication technologies (ICT) provide significant opportunities to improve teaching and learning. The use of ICT in science education offers even more advantages due to the attractive premises to simulate and interactively explore and test experiments which would be too expensive or too dangerous in real settings (for example in nuclear physics). The aim of this paper is to contribute to the research field of technology based learning by presenting several findings obtained during a multinational educational project (Comenius) regarding the use of computer in classroom, in science education, in Romania, Spain, Poland, Greece and Finland.
